X-Git-Url: https://scm.cri.minesparis.psl.eu/git/Plinn.git/blobdiff_plain/3c4367d8e03450e9a73e61f4247145d2b6c86a33..959d888c17d1403d2eeecc19bc4b5e2c8d1debf6:/skins/control/restore_revision.py?ds=sidebyside diff --git a/skins/control/restore_revision.py b/skins/control/restore_revision.py deleted file mode 100755 index 16eb3f8..0000000 --- a/skins/control/restore_revision.py +++ /dev/null @@ -1,10 +0,0 @@ -##parameters=key, ajax='' -from Products.Plinn.utils import getAdapterByInterface, translate -def _(message) : return translate(message, context).encode('utf-8') -req = context.REQUEST - -history = getAdapterByInterface(context, 'Products.Plinn.interfaces.IContentHistory') -history.restore(key) - -req.other['portal_status_message'] = _("%(type)s restored.") % {'type':context.getPortalTypeName()} -context.setRedirect(context, 'object/view', ajax=ajax, syncFragments = ['Breadcrumbs']) \ No newline at end of file